Mastering Copy, Paste, and Other Essential Shortcuts

Copying, pasting, and other basic keyboard shortcuts are some of the most time-saving tricks you can use on your computer. Whether you’re working in Word, Excel, email, or web browsers, mastering these shortcuts can boost productivity and reduce repetitive actions.

📌 Copy, Cut, and Paste Shortcuts

Ctrl + C – Copy selected text, images, or files.
Ctrl + X – Cut (removes the item and copies it to the clipboard).
Ctrl + V – Paste the last copied or cut item.
Ctrl + Shift + V – Paste without formatting (great for plain text).

📌 Undo and Redo Shortcuts

Ctrl + Z – Undo the last action.
Ctrl + Y – Redo the last undone action.

📌 Selecting Text and Items Quickly

Ctrl + A – Select everything in a document, folder, or webpage.
Shift + Arrow Keys – Select text one character or line at a time.
Ctrl + Shift + Arrow Keys – Select words or paragraphs quickly.
Ctrl + Click – Select multiple files or items (Windows & Mac).
Shift + Click – Select a range of items (great for emails or files).

📌 Formatting Text Faster

Ctrl + B – Bold selected text.
Ctrl + I – Italicize selected text.
Ctrl + U – Underline selected text.
Ctrl + Shift + > – Increase font size.
Ctrl + Shift + < – Decrease font size.

📌 File and Folder Management Shortcuts

Ctrl + N – Open a new document or window.
Ctrl + O – Open an existing file.
Ctrl + S – Save the current file.
Ctrl + P – Print the current document.
Ctrl + W – Close the current window.
Alt + Tab – Switch between open applications.

📌 Clipboard History (Windows Only)

Win + V – Open Clipboard History (view and paste previously copied items).
Ctrl + Shift + V – Paste without formatting.

✅ Enable Clipboard History under Settings > System > Clipboard to store multiple copied items!


📌 Quick Shortcuts for Web Browsing

Ctrl + T – Open a new browser tab.
Ctrl + W – Close the current tab.
Ctrl + L – Highlight the address bar for quick URL entry.
Ctrl + D – Bookmark the current page.
Ctrl + Shift + T – Reopen the last closed tab.
